If you're planning to buy train tickets or collect those purchased online, West Drayton Station offers convenient options. Ticket office hours are generous, with full-day service during the week and reduced hours on Sundays. Ticket machines are also available for quick and easy purchases, and they are accessible to all passengers. Unfortunately, while the station doesn't offer smartcard facilities, it compensates with its accessible ticket services and helpful staff presence.
For those needing a bit of guidance or information, the station provides excellent customer support, including help points and information screens. Accessibility is a prime focus too, with step-free access, accessible toilets, and wheelchairs available to ensure a comfortable journey for everyone. For those waiting for a train, heated waiting rooms and platform seating make the experience more pleasant.
Despite its array of services, it's worth noting that West Drayton Station doesn't have refreshment facilities, shops, or ATM machines on-site. Public Wi-Fi is also unavailable, so come prepared with your own connectivity solutions if needed.
West Drayton provides excellent transport links for onward journeys. Bus stops right outside the station serve TfL routes, making your local travel plan straightforward and efficient. For those headed to Heathrow Airport, the Elizabeth Line offers a seamless connection, with a simple change needed at Hayes & Harlington. Alternatively, local bus services can take you directly from the station to the airport.

Hornbeam Park Station is all about convenience. While it doesn't boast a ticket office, fear not—ticket machines are available to ensure you can purchase your fare hassle-free. These machines are accessible and equipped with induction loops, though they're cashless, so make sure to have your card ready. For the tech-savvy traveler, smartcards are issued and validated here too, facilitating smooth commutes.
While staff assistance isn't available on-site, helpful resources like customer information screens and announcements ensure you won't miss your train. In case you need help, helplines are just a call away. Relax about your luggage because there's no dedicated storage, but remember that CCTV is in operation for peace of mind.
The station has limited seating and amenities, so it's best for those who prefer to arrive just in time. While there's ample cycle storage with CCTV coverage, accessible parking and car park equipment are limited, making alternative travel arrangements more favorable.
At Hornbeam Park, you'll find that connectivity is just a few steps away. It's easy to hop onto the regular bus services, with nearby stops ensuring a swift transition from train to road. Check out the busline 0871 200 2233 for schedule information. If you're planning on catching a taxi, the cab booking service from Northern Railway makes it simple. Rail replacement services are conveniently located on Hookstone Road, offering added flexibility should the need arise.
